Denmark uses specific electric socket types and standards that travelers should be aware of to ensure device compatibility and safety.
- Plug Types: Type C (Europlug) and Type K are the primary socket types. Type F plugs are also commonly compatible.
- Voltage and Frequency: Standard supply is 230V at 50Hz.
- Compatibility: Most European plugs (Type C, E, F, K) fit Danish sockets. Devices from the US (Type A/B, 120V), UK (Type G, 230V), and Australia (Type I, 230V) require plug adapters. US devices also need voltage converters unless rated for 230V.
- Adapters and Converters: Adapters are widely available at airports, hotels, and electronics stores. Voltage converters are necessary for non-230V devices.
- Safety Tips: Ensure devices are compatible with 230V to avoid damage. Use surge protectors for sensitive electronics. Type K sockets are grounded; ungrounded plugs may not fit securely.
- Local Practices: Multi-plug adapters are common in hotels. Power outages are rare and typically brief.
